SuperOps vs Syncro: on our data-weighted scoring, Syncro edges ahead (7.9 vs 7.8/10). SuperOps starts at $79/tech/mo and is best for modern msps wanting a clean unified rmm+psa with ai built in; Syncro starts at $139/user/mo and is best for small msps wanting rmm + psa + billing at one per-user price. Choose Syncro for the stronger overall track record; consider SuperOps if its pricing model or fit matches your environment better. Side-by-side table below.

Syncro bills on a per user model from $139/user/mo (yes trial), while SuperOps uses a per technician model from $79/tech/mo (14 days trial). Because the models differ, the cheaper option flips depending on your fleet size — model both at your seat/endpoint count.
Syncro ships 5 headline capabilities (RMM + PSA combined, Unlimited endpoints per user, Invoicing + payments, Patch management) and deploys Cloud. SuperOps ships 5 (Unified RMM + PSA, AI-assisted ops, Patch management, Project management), deploying Cloud.
